From ef9370582b8a9ccb83dc62008056893aa6baf9be Mon Sep 17 00:00:00 2001 From: Vincent Hardouin Date: Tue, 8 Oct 2024 18:55:38 +0200 Subject: [PATCH] feat: add event attributes https://developer.apple.com/documentation/walletpasses/semantictags --- src/infrastructure/PassAdapter.js |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/src/infrastructure/PassAdapter.js b/src/infrastructure/PassAdapter.js index 9a716f2..1ead27d 100644 --- a/src/infrastructure/PassAdapter.js +++ b/src/infrastructure/PassAdapter.js @@ -27,9 +27,15 @@ class PassAdapter { passTypeIdentifier, teamIdentifier: this.config.teamIdentifier, logoText: title, - relevantDate: start, webServiceURL: this.baseURL, authenticationToken: token, + maxDistance: 100, + relevantDate: start, + semantics: { + eventStartDate: start, + eventEndDate: new Date(new Date(start).setHours(start.getHours() + 1)), + duration: 3600, + }, }, );